When staying at Lido Beach Holiday Park, you’ll find plenty of popular seaside destinations waiting to be explored across the North Wales coastline.

Just moments from the park, Prestatyn offers a lovely stretch of sandy beach, a bustling promenade and a fantastic selection of shops, cafés and restaurants to discover throughout your stay. The town is also well-known as the starting point of Offa’s Dyke Path, making it a brilliant spot for walkers wanting to take in the surrounding scenery.

A short drive along the coast will bring you to Rhyl, one of North Wales’ most popular seaside towns. Here, you’ll find everything from amusement arcades and fairground rides to family attractions such as the SC2 Waterpark and SeaQuarium Rhyl.

For a quieter day by the coast, head towards the charming seaside village of Rhos-on-Sea, where you’ll find a peaceful promenade, cosy cafés and beautiful sea views stretching across the bay.

PRESTATYN

Colwyn Bay 16 miles; Llandudno 24 miles; Chester 31 miles; Snowdonia National Park 33 miles.

One of the many renowned seaside resorts along the lovely North Wales coastline, the charming town of Prestatyn offers four miles of golden sand divided between three great beaches, all of which are ideal for family fun. Offering the perfect base for walkers and cyclists with dedicated cycle routes leading along the beautiful coastline, the town also hosts the beginning of the 8th Century Offa's Dyke Pathway and a Roman bath house, whilst the surrounding hills and nearby Clwydian Hill Range offer breathtaking views not to be missed! Discover the beautiful Snowdonia National Park, Victorian Llandudno, the Welsh Mountain Zoo, Conwy, Rhuddlan and Denbigh Castles, or historic Chester with its wonderful shops and architecture.
